Sounds complicated, and I don't really see the use case for controlling the direct SSL support in such a fine-grained fashion. It would be nice if we could reject non-SSL connections before the client sends the startup packet, but that's not possible because in a plaintext connection, that's the first packet that the client sends. The reverse would be possible: reject SSLRequest or direct SSL connection immediately, if HBA doesn't allow non-SSL connections from that IP address. But that's not very interesting.
